Join us for our next Native Nonprofits 101 workshop! Designed to give you information and tools to help you run your nonprofit, this series provides you with practical, hands-on learning. We will share tips and tools for small to midsize organizations, whether staffed or all-volunteer.
When: Thursday, June 12, 2025 8:30 am to 3:30 pm. *Breakfast & lunch provided.
Where: Legends Casino Toppenish, WA - 580 Fort Rd, Toppenish, WA 98948
We will explore these topics:
RELATIONSHIPS
Boards and Governance: Learn how to create a board that can support your mission.
Human Resources: Learn how to structure a people strategy that engages people in your mission, whether they are paid or volunteers.
SUPPORT
Fundraising: Create a fundraising strategy that honors cultural values and connects with donors.
Financial Management: Learn what to look for in financial reports and how to build a budget that reflects your full costs.
NONPROFIT ESSENTIALS
State Law: Learn what you need to know to be compliant in Washington State, including Tribally-located nonprofits.
Federal Law: Find out what federal rules every nonprofit must follow.
Worker-Related Rules: Learn what worker-related rules apply to nonprofits in Washington State.
